This year also sees the first live exhibition event held at the ICE gaming expo, with eight teams including NAVI and ENCE competing for a reported prize pool of $250,000\u00a0<sup><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><span style=\"font-size: 10px;\">[1]<\/span><\/span><\/sup>.\u00a0Considering that the event will be streamed live, as with any other event, what are the benefits of watching the event in person \u2013 how do the two experiences compare to one another?<\/p>\n<p>While there is a significant body of research which has investigated the differences between live attendance at traditional sporting events and consuming them via broadcast media, the same cannot be said for esports. Given that esports are watched by hundreds of millions of people every year, and that many esports have overtaken large traditional sports in spectator numbers (although there is debate about the way in which the figures are calculated)\u00a0<sup><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><span style=\"font-size: 10px;\">[2]<\/span><\/span><\/sup>, there is a need to further understand attendance behaviour for a comparatively new cultural phenomenon. Indeed, esports has additional points of interest concerning live attendance as it is an activity which is primarily mediated through internet technologies.<\/p>\n<p>We have recently published \u201c<a href=\"https:\/\/www.emerald.com\/insight\/content\/doi\/10.1108\/INTR-07-2018-0304\/full\/html?casa_token=4fVKuNOB5_QAAAAA:GgJgU0Zz1AQDptACocCeEF015A-OwfvzrQe-n_3lSW--mACcfkj52t76WwvFJTxQGdXI-bztrpMTAgxXdCCWjik7KScI8tiD701S5nXjYic1jsmPS4od\">Digital athletics in analogue stadiums: Comparing gratifications for engagement between live attendance and online esports spectating<\/a>\u201d\u00a0<sup><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><span style=\"font-size: 10px;\">[3]<\/span><\/span><\/sup>, in which we found significant difference between online spectators and live attendees. Online spectators were found to rate the motivational factors of drama, acquisition of knowledge, appreciation of skill, novelty, aesthetics and enjoyment of aggression higher than live attendees. Correspondingly, social interaction and physical attractiveness were rated higher by live attendees. Vicarious achievement and physical attractiveness positively predicted intention to attend live sports events while vicarious achievement and novelty positively predicted future online consumption of esports. Finally, vicarious achievement and novelty positively predicted recommending esports to others.<\/p>\n<p>These results are particularly interesting when compared to traditional sports where motivational factors such as drama, for example, have been found to be more strongly associated with live attendance\u00a0<sup><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><span style=\"font-size: 10px;\">[4]<\/span><\/span><\/sup>. This study offers one of the first attempts to compare online spectating and live attendance, in order to better understand both the phenomenon and the consumers involved. As the growth of esports is predicted to continue in the coming years, further understanding of this phenomenon is pivotal for multiple stakeholder groups.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><strong>Digital athletics in analogue stadiums: Comparing gratifications for engagement between live attendance and online esports spectating<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/webpages.tuni.fi\/gamification\/members\/m-sjoblom\/\">Max Sj\u00f6blom<\/a><\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/webpages.tuni.fi\/gamification\/members\/joseph-macey\/\">Joseph Macey<\/a><\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/webpages.tuni.fi\/gamification\/members\/j-hamari\/\">Juho Hamari<\/a><\/p>\n<p><strong>Reference<\/strong>: Sj\u00f6blom, M., Macey, J., &amp; Hamari, J. Ahead-of-print. doi:\u00a010.1108\/INTR-07-2018-0304.<\/p>\n<p><strong>See the paper for full details:<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.emerald.com\/insight\/content\/doi\/10.1108\/INTR-07-2018-0304\/full\/html?casa_token=4fVKuNOB5_QAAAAA:GgJgU0Zz1AQDptACocCeEF015A-OwfvzrQe-n_3lSW--mACcfkj52t76WwvFJTxQGdXI-bztrpMTAgxXdCCWjik7KScI8tiD701S5nXjYic1jsmPS4od\">Journal<\/a><\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.researchgate.net\/publication\/338446298_Digital_athletics_in_analogue_stadiums_Comparing_gratifications_for_engagement_between_live_attendance_and_online_esports_spectating\">ResearchGate<\/a><\/p>\n<p><strong>Abstract<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Esports (electronic sports) are watched by hundreds of millions of people every year and many esports have overtaken large traditional sports in spectator numbers. The purpose of this paper is to investigate spectating differences between online spectating of esports and live attendance of esports events. This is done in order to further understand attendance behaviour for a cultural phenomenon that is primarily mediated through internet technologies, and to be able to predict behavioural patterns.<\/p>\n<p><b>References:<\/b><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-size: 12px;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">[1]ICE London.
